An AI-generated image can establish an architectural expectation almost instantly.

A developer might arrive with a dramatic hospitality concept created through a text prompt. An interior designer may use AI to explore a material palette before the space has been modeled. A client may circulate an image that captures exactly how they want a future residence, resort, amenity space, or mixed-use destination to feel.

These images can be powerful. They give teams a common visual reference, accelerate early conversations, and make abstract ambitions easier to communicate.

They can also create a significant gap between what has been imagined and what the project can actually become.

The challenge is no longer simply generating the idea. It is translating that idea into a controlled visual environment that respects the architecture, responds to the project information, and remains useful as the design develops.

AI Images Are Becoming Part of the Project Brief

AI-generated references are entering architectural projects earlier and more frequently. In Chaos research involving architecture and visualization professionals, 43 percent of respondents identified concept and pre-design as the stage where AI adds the most value. At the same time, only 20 percent said AI had been fully integrated into their workflows.

AI is already influencing expectations, even when the processes for reviewing, controlling, and developing its output are still evolving.

For project teams, an AI image can function much like a sophisticated mood board. It may communicate:

  • A desired atmosphere
  • Material character
  • Lighting and time of day
  • Landscape density
  • A hospitality or residential aesthetic
  • The intended level of luxury
  • A general architectural language
  • The type of experience the client wants to create

Used this way, AI can improve the brief. It gives the visualization team more information about intent than a collection of disconnected reference images might provide.

Problems begin when the image is treated as resolved architecture.

What an AI Concept Usually Does Not Resolve

An AI image can appear exceptionally convincing while containing spatial and architectural contradictions.

A compelling facade may not correspond to a workable floor plan. Windows may change shape or alignment. Structural spans may be implausible. Furniture, doors, stairs, and circulation routes may not relate to one another. Materials can shift unpredictably across a series of images.

The image may also omit the less visible requirements that determine whether a place works, including:

  • Building code and accessibility
  • Structure and mechanical systems
  • Accurate dimensions
  • Constructability
  • Site conditions
  • Adjacencies and circulation
  • Consistent architectural geometry
  • Real product and material specifications
  • Coordination between exterior and interior views

This does not make the AI image useless. It means the team needs to understand what the image represents.

It is a statement of intent, not necessarily a set of instructions.

The American Institute of Architects’ guidance on responsible AI use emphasizes professional oversight, transparency, and care as AI becomes more involved in architectural practice. These principles are especially relevant when generated imagery begins influencing client decisions.

Turning Visual Intent Into a Controlled Environment

The first step is to identify what the client actually values in the reference.

Is it the building form? The color temperature? The relationship between architecture and landscape? The sense of arrival? The density of activity? The material restraint? The emotional tone?

Once those priorities are understood, they can be separated from details that are accidental, contradictory, or impossible to reproduce.

The visualization process can then connect the aspiration to real project information, including:

  • Architectural drawings
  • CAD or BIM models
  • Civil and landscape plans
  • Interior design packages
  • Finish schedules
  • Product selections
  • Site photography
  • Survey information
  • Brand guidelines
  • Marketing objectives

A professional 3D environment gives the project a consistent foundation. Cameras can be positioned deliberately. Materials can be coordinated. Daylight can be studied. Architectural changes can be incorporated without reinventing the entire image.

Most importantly, every view can refer to the same project.

This is where a controlled 3D workflow differs fundamentally from generating a series of visually related images. The environment has continuity. If a facade changes, that change can carry through exterior renderings, animations, interactive tours, and supporting marketing imagery.

Resolve the Design Before Expanding the Content

AI makes it possible to explore a large number of directions quickly. That can be valuable, but more options do not always create more clarity.

If several AI references contain conflicting geometries, materials, or styles, the visualization team must determine which elements are authoritative. Otherwise, the project can enter an expensive cycle of revisions driven by images that were never coordinated in the first place.

Before production begins, teams should agree on:

  1. Which parts of the AI image are essential
  2. Which parts are only atmospheric references
  3. Which drawings or models control the architecture
  4. Which materials and products have been approved
  5. Who consolidates design feedback
  6. Which audiences the final visuals need to reach
  7. Which future deliverables should use the same visual environment

This turns the AI reference into a productive starting point instead of an unstable target.

Architectural Accuracy and Aspiration Can Coexist

Accuracy does not mean removing the emotion that made the original concept attractive.

A strong visualization studio should preserve the image’s ambition while making it credible. That may involve refining the composition, selecting a more realistic material, adjusting the landscape, or finding a camera that communicates the intended drama without misrepresenting the project.

The goal is not to reproduce every artifact in an AI image. It is to understand why the image resonated and carry that quality into a visual that remains accountable to the design.

This balance is especially important for projects using imagery to support investment, approvals, pre-sales, leasing, or public communication. A visual must inspire interest, but it must also build confidence.

One Environment, Multiple Project Uses

Once an accurate visual environment has been established, its value can extend well beyond a single rendering.

The same coordinated project can support:

  • Photoreal exterior and interior images
  • Cinematic animation
  • Interactive browser-based tours
  • Design presentations
  • Investor and capital materials
  • Planning and stakeholder communication
  • Pre-leasing or pre-sales campaigns
  • Social and launch content
  • Updated imagery as the design evolves

This is the real opportunity created by hybrid AI and 3D workflows.

AI can accelerate exploration, reference development, visual refinement, and selected production tasks. A controlled 3D environment creates the consistency and accuracy needed to turn that exploration into a durable project asset.

What to Send a Visualization Studio

If your team has already developed AI-generated concepts, include them in the brief. They can be extremely useful when accompanied by the right context.

Provide:

  • The AI images that best represent the intended direction
  • Notes identifying what you like in each image
  • Current drawings, models, and consultant information
  • A list of elements that must remain architecturally accurate
  • Confirmed materials or product selections
  • The audiences and decisions the visuals need to support
  • Known future uses, such as animation or an interactive experience

The clearer the distinction between inspiration and confirmed design, the more efficiently the visualization team can work.

The Valuable Work Begins After the Prompt

AI can establish an expectation in seconds. The harder and more valuable work is translating that expectation into a visual system that remains faithful to the actual project.

For developers, architects, and design teams, the best result does not come from choosing between AI and traditional 3D production. It comes from understanding what each is equipped to do.

AI is exceptionally useful for exploration. Controlled visualization is what turns that exploration into a consistent, credible, and commercially useful representation of the project.
